    Yanks open their 7th Stadium today (4-2 past openings):

    Odds favor the Yankees today, as they are 4-2 in new stadium openings since the inception of the franchise, with losses in their first games at Hilltop Park in 1903 and the Polo Grounds in 1913, and wins in their debuts in Oriole Park (as the original Baltimore Orioles) in 1901, The House that Ruth built in 1923, in Shea stadium, which was their home during the 1974-75 remodel, and in renovated Yankee Stadium -- which truly was a different park than the original model -- in 1976.
